Miss Nichols is a native
Californian. She graduated from Berkeley High School, then earned an
associate degree in history at Merritt Jr.
College and went on to California State University Hayward, where she
earned a
bachelor’s degree in social science with a minor in geography. Then she
studied further to obtain her teaching credentials. Miss Nichols has
been at King’s Valley Christian School for sixteen years. She has
taught a variety of age groups and currently teaches first grade.
Miss Nichols’ love for children has been her primary focus for many
years; however, in her spare time she enjoys photography, gardening, and
the study of ancient civilizations. Miss Nichols loves the Lord and
enjoys her time in the Word. Her goal, with the Lord’s guidance,
is to mold young people spiritually, academically and emotionally
according to the will of God.
